              Originally posted by ubernoob
              You're not showing anything. You're showing a processor running at no load with a severe underclock.

              I was in game when my picture was taken.

              Nobody lies about AMD being hotter. That's in relation to graphics cards. AMDs processors have a lower safe max temp. That's why your max is 70C and mine is 91C. Especially the Vishera series.

              Intel will run warmer for processors.
